Saw your comments there. Editor652 and his sock drawer seem to have a personal obsession with this topic, not a desire to vandalize Wikipedia in general. He edits articles about South American airports as well, and, so far as I can tell, does so responsibly and accurately. The historical background is that the Honduran government is guilty of census underreporting, and has tweaked the definition of "black" so that not many citizens will qualify. That puts us into a WP:V problem, because we suspect the "true" number is higher than the "verifiable" number. Multiple editors have tried to find a reliable number that is larger than the 150K quoted in the article, and worked constructively with Editor652 when he edited in that persona. None of us could find a source, even though we could understand his point. Ultimately, he began just inserting personal best guesses into the article, and got blocked for it. He resurrected himself as Honduran72, MTA25, MTA254, various anonymous IPs, and continued. That means he is now blocked for block evasion, and, whether he is personally right or wrong, can't edit.Kww (talk) 18:37, 1 May 2008 (UTC)

Sleeper accounts

What do you mean, sleeper accounts? Bob the Wikipedian, the Tree of Life WikiDragon (talk) 02:10, 2 May 2008 (UTC)

Sleeper accounts are usually created (in great numbers) by a troll or a sockpuppetter for the sole purpose of not being used until either (1)their main account or IP has besomed blocked, or more common (2)until the account has been auto-confirmed allowing them to edit semi-protected pages. Often sleeper accounts will go unused for years. Hope that helps, Tiptoety talk 02:54, 2 May 2008 (UTC)
